(b)  Cashless Exercise. In lieu of exercising the Warrant by Cash Exercise, the Registered Holder may satisfy its obligation to pay the Aggregate Exercise Price for the Warrant Shares through a "cashless exercise," in which event the Company shall issue to the Registered Holder the number of Warrant Shares determined as follows:
 
 
X = Y [(A-B)/A]
where:
 
 
X = the number of Warrant Shares to be issued to the Holder.
   
 
Y = the number of Warrant Shares with respect to which this Warrant is being exercised.
   
 
A = the arithmetic average of the Last Sale Price of the Common Stock for the five Trading Days immediately prior to (but not including) the Exercise Time.
   
 
B = the Exercise Price.

SECTION 2.   Adjustment of Exercise Price and Number of Shares. In order to prevent dilution of the rights granted under this Warrant, the Initial Exercise Price shall be subject to adjustment from time to time as provided in this Section 2 (such price or such price as last adjusted pursuant to the terms hereof, as the case may be, is herein called the "Exercise Price"), and the number of Warrant Shares obtainable upon exercise of this Warrant shall be subject to adjustment from time to time as provided in this Section 2.
 
(a)  Reorganization, Reclassification, Consolida-tion, Merger or Sale. In case of any reclassification, capital reorganization, consolidation, merger, sale of all or substan-tially all of the Company's assets to another Person or any other change in the Common Stock of the Company, other than as a result of a subdivision, combination, or stock dividend provided for in Section 2(b) below (any of which, a "Change Event"), then, as a condition of such Change Event, lawful provision shall be made, and duly executed documents evidencing the same from the Company or its successor shall be delivered to the Registered Holder, so that the Registered Holder shall have the right at any time prior to the expiration of this Warrant to purchase, at a total price equal to that payable upon the exercise of this Warrant (subject to adjustment of the Exercise Price as provided in Section 2), the kind and amount of shares of stock and other securities and property receivable in connection with such Change Event by a holder of the same number of shares of Common Stock as were purchasable by the Registered Holder immediately prior to such Change Event. In any such case appropriate provisions shall be made with respect to the rights and interest of the Registered Holder so that the provisions hereof shall thereafter be applicable with respect to any shares of stock or other securities and property deliverable upon exercise hereof, and appropriate adjustments shall be made to the purchase price per share payable hereunder, provided the aggregate purchase price shall remain the same.
 
3

 
(b)  Subdivisions, Combinations and Other Issuances. If the Company shall at any time prior to the expiration of this Warrant (i) subdivide its Common Stock, by split-up or otherwise, or combine its Common Stock, or (ii) issue additional shares of its Common Stock or other equity securities as a dividend with respect to any shares of its Common Stock, the number of shares of Common Stock issuable on the exercise of this Warrant shall forthwith be proportionately increased in the case of a subdivision or stock, or proportionately decreased in the case of a combination. Appropriate adjustments shall also be made to the purchase price payable per share, but the aggregate purchase price payable for the total number of Warrant Shares purchasable under this Warrant (as adjusted) shall remain the same. Any adjustment under this Section 2(b) shall become effective at the close of business on the date the subdivision or combination becomes effective, or as of the record date of such dividend, or in the event that no record date is fixed, upon the making of such dividend.
